HAUSLAND TO LAUNCH HUE GROUNDS IN Q2 2026, REDEFINING ACTIVE LIFESTYLE DESTINATIONS IN PAMPANGA
Angeles City, Pampanga — The growing momentum of sports and community-driven lifestyles in Pampanga is set to reach new heights as Hausland Holdings Inc. prepares to officially launch HUE Grounds, a dynamic new lifestyle and sports destination, in the second quarter of 2026.
The announcement was made by Atty. Christopher Ryan C. Tan, President and CEO of Hausland Holdings Inc., during the launch of the Hausland CIFA Cup 2026 Football Festival—an event that underscores the region’s rapidly expanding football culture.
Located within the emerging Timog Triangle along Friendship Highway, HUE Grounds is thoughtfully designed as an integrated hub where sport, wellness, and social experiences converge. At its core are two tournament-grade natural grass football pitches, which is among the very few in Pampanga, built to accommodate both 7-a-side and full 11-a-side matches. These premium-quality fields set a new standard for football facilities in the region and respond directly to the increasing demand for high-caliber playing environments.
Complementing its football offerings are two pickleball courts, reflecting the rise of one of the fastest-growing recreational sports globally, as well as four carefully curated café and restaurant spaces that aim to create a vibrant, community-centered atmosphere beyond the field of play.
Developed by Hausland Urban Estates Corp. (HUE), the group’s newest venture focused on forward-thinking estate developments, the project embodies a vision of creating purposeful spaces that bring people together. Commercial leasing and overall ecosystem curation will be managed by Hausland Commercial Inc. (HCI), ensuring a cohesive mix of tenants and experiences aligned with the brand’s lifestyle direction.
